1、介绍Qt 是一个跨平台的 C++ 图形用户界面应用程序框架,提供给应用程序开发者建立艺术级的图形用户界面所需的所用功能。Qt 可以帮助我们轻松地使用 C++ 开发跨平台的 GUI 程序。 在树莓派上,使用 Qt 来开发图形用户界面应用程序同样轻而易举。本文中将介绍如何在树莓派上安装 Qt Creator,并制作一个简单的应用程序。 由于 Qt 是跨平台的,这就意味着在 Windows 下使用
前面的文章我们介绍了WiringPi的配置函数,今天这篇文章,我们来介绍下核心函数。1、void pinMode(int pin,int mode)该函数用来设置树莓引脚的工作模式,共有两个参数:第一个参数是引脚的编号,具体采用哪种编号规则由配置函数决定;第二个参数是要设置的工作模式,共有四种工作模式可以选择,包括:输入(INPUT)、输出(OUTPUT)、PWM输出(PWM_OU
## 树莓前景 Qt Python实现步骤 ### 1. 确认开发环境 在开始实现"树莓前景 Qt Python"之前,首先需要确认你已经安装好了以下环境: - 树莓操作系统(Raspbian等) - Qt开发环境 - Python解释器 如果你还没有安装这些环境,请先进行安装。 ### 2. 创建Qt项目 在开始具体编码之前,我们需要首先创建一个Qt项目。请按照下面的步骤创建一个Q
原创 2023-11-11 08:53:39
100阅读
Python是一种广泛使用的高级编程语言,而Qt则是一种跨平台的应用程序开发框架。树莓是一种小型的单板计算机,因其体积小巧且价格低廉而受到广大开发者的喜爱。在本文中,我们将介绍如何使用PythonQt来控制树莓派上的按钮,并提供了相应的代码示例。 在开始之前,我们需要先了解一些基本概念。Qt是一个功能强大且易于使用的应用程序开发框架,它提供了丰富的图形用户界面(GUI)组件,可以用于创建各种
原创 2024-02-02 11:10:06
39阅读
本文是《14 天学会树莓使用》系列文章的第一篇。虽然本系列文章主要面向没有使用过树莓或 Linux 或没有编程经验的人群,但是肯定有些东西还是需要有经验的读者的,我希望这些读者能够留下他们有益的评论、提示和补充。如果每个人都能贡献,这将会让本系列文章对初学者、其它有经验的读者、甚至是我更受益!言归正传,如果你想拥有一个树莓,但不知道应该买哪个型号。或许你希望为你的教学活动或你的孩子买一个,但
1.基本方法 sudo apt-get install qt5-default //安装默认基本库 sudo apt-get install qtcreator sudo apt-get install qtdeclarative5-dev //安装QtQuick sudo apt-get inst ...
转载 2021-10-18 12:27:00
1328阅读
2评论
树莓中安装QT 本文博客链接:http://blog.csdn.net/jdh99,作者:jdh,转载请注明. 环境: 主机:WIN7 硬件:树莓 步骤: 参考链接:http://qt-project.org/wiki/apt-get_Qt4_on_the_Raspberry_Pi Firstl Read More
转载 2016-12-09 23:40:00
270阅读
2评论
树莓3b上编译uboot 在树莓3b上编译uboot1.说明2.代码编译2.1 交叉编译工具链下载2.2 源代码下载3.固件下载与使用4.待完善的功能toc1.说明最近想研究一下树莓3b的一些底层驱动的代码,比较好的就是直接可以看树莓3b的实现。因为usb驱动,网卡驱动,以及lcd驱动,都可以在uboot中直接找到。有了这些东西,对于我们直接写树莓3b的驱动程序,提供了极大的帮助,所以
整体介绍:这是一个用QT编写的,运行在树莓派上的小程序,当然运行在PC上也是可以的一、树莓准备工作1、树莓
原创 2022-09-20 10:47:57
1280阅读
树莓中安装QT  环境: 主机:WIN7 硬件:树莓  步骤: Firstly I got the development tools needed by Qt Creator in the hope it would be less heavy for the Pi to download separately. sudo apt-get install qt4-dev-to
转载 2013-03-30 16:41:00
217阅读
首先,我想说明,只是为了学习Python完全没有问题,官方系统自带Python环境,不过日常使用推荐二手笔记本啦,想要用起来舒服树莓得折腾,而且配置确实是太低了,(四核1.2+1g)。不过我还是要前排强行安利树莓,就简单说说我用树莓做过的小项目吧,首先是Python爬虫一系列,多线程无压力。Python+OpenCV人脸识别,无压力。Python+flask ,小型论坛,百人访问量(不许笑)
到目前为止,我们所有的树莓4BPython程序都是通过使用IDLE或通过控制台窗口执行的。但是,我们可能希望我们的程序在启动时自动运行,在本方法文档中我们将学习如何在Raspbian上执行此操作!为什么在启动时运行脚本?大多数计算机用户将熟悉基于用户界面的程序,这些程序需要用户输入才能执行操作。例如,游戏采用用户操作虚拟角色的键盘和鼠标数据来运行,跳跃,游泳和爬行。其他应用程序(例如办公程序)包
wiringpi2显然也把i2c驱动带给了Python,手头上正巧有一个DS3231的模块,上边带了一个DS3231 RTC(实时时钟),与一片24C32,两个芯片均为iic总线设备,与树莓接线如下: 也就是VCC GND SDA SCL四个脚分别接到树莓的1(3.3v)、9(0v)、3(SDA.1)、5(SCL.1)上,因为树莓的I2C接口默认是关闭的,需要先编辑一下/boot/confi
提示:文章写完后,目录可以自动生成,如何生成可参考右边的帮助文档 文章目录前言一、树莓安装64位系统二、树莓前期准备三、配置部署环境四、安装yolov5环境运行程序五、配置环境中的坑 前言树莓派上部署yolov5(运行yolov5-lite同样可以) 使用树莓最新版的64位系统 硬件是树莓4B4G版本,python版本是3.9一、树莓安装64位系统1.下载镜像文件树莓官方镜像文件下载(
 ▌第一部分 环境解决1.1 软件版本发货前已经配置好软件环境:Linux raspberrypi 5.4.51Python 3.7OpenCV-python 3.4.6.271.2 TF卡克隆软件⊙ 软件包准备⊙ 解压缩到文件夹,并打开 ▲ Win32DiskImage解压缩之后目录 ⊙ 打开软件 ⊙ 建立img文件当前需要备份的文件夹下面,新建一个*.img文件,比如:lqpi
转载 2024-01-29 20:47:41
40阅读
首先更新树莓派系统 $ sudo apt-get update $ sudo apt-get upgrade 接着安装python依赖环境 $ sudo apt-get install build-essential libsqlite3-dev sqlite3 bzip2 libbz2-dev 然后下载python3.6版本源码并解压 $ wget https://www.python.org/
转载 2023-06-27 18:26:25
331阅读
学习目录:树莓学习之路-GPIO Zero 官网地址:https://gpiozero.readthedocs.io/en/stable/recipes_advanced.html环境:UbuntuMeta-16.04树莓:3代B型以下方法演示了GPIO Zero库的一些功能。 需要注意的是所有方法都是在 Python 3 的情况下编写的。方法可能在 Python 2 没有用 !3.1. LE
转载 2023-10-07 13:15:14
95阅读
一:格式化SD卡SD卡插入读卡器连接电脑,使用SDFormatter对SD卡进行格式化(重装烧录也要进行着SD卡格式化操作)二:下载官方镜像http://downloads.raspberrypi.org/raspbian_latest三:烧录SD卡使用Win32DiskImager将镜像烧录到格式化后的SD卡SD卡盘根目录(/boot)下新建一个命名为ssh的文件(无后缀)四:Putty连接连接
转载 2023-08-24 15:20:25
148阅读
GPIO库的核心功能,当然就是操作GPIO了,GPIO就是“通用输入/输出”接口,比如点亮一个LED、继电器等,或者通过iic spi 1-wire等协议,读取、写入数据,这都是GPIO的用处,可以说没有GPIO,树莓只能当小电脑用,有了GPIO,就升级成一个控制器了。先来说说怎么操作一个数字量(高低电平)。先看代码: import wiringpi2 as gpio from wiringp
转载 2023-06-16 14:25:37
310阅读
基于我个人习惯. 即使在树莓派上面,也习惯整一个可视化页面出来环境说明硬件 : 任意树莓~我是 3B+ 和 4OS : Raspberry Pi OS开发语言 : Python可视化UI开发 : PyQt5开发流程说明分别在开发电脑和树莓派上面先搭建好所有环境,包括 开发语言环境:Python 核心组件:PyQt5、pyqt-tools、Designer.使用Designer画页面,保存生成 .
  • 1
  • 2
  • 3
  • 4
  • 5